Understanding the Science Behind the Vocal Cords

Before we dive in, let’s talk about the basics. The human vocal cords are made up of muscles and tissues that vibrate when air is passed through them. Men have thicker vocal cords that produce deeper sounds compared to women whose cords are thinner resulting in a higher pitch. Practice Your Breathing

It might surprise you, but breathing deeply can help deepen your voice too! Inhale deeply into your belly pushing it out (not just raising your shoulders), then exhale slowly with control. This exercise helps you draw more air into your lungs which allows for smoother sound production as well.
